Yeah, I don't think we win without the onside kick. We weren't in control of the game from the end of the Henry touchdown all the way until that play. We were on our heels for the next two quarters. After the onside kick, we were never behind again, and were up by two scores at two different points in the game.

it changed the game completely. Stole a possession back, and put us on the offensive. Without it, I think Alabama's chance to win was probably at 45-50%, after it and the ensuing TD, I think it rose to like 80%.
